Page 3: Passive Voice INVENTIONS

WHAT IS THE RULE?

Active• Someone does

something.

• Henry Ford built the car.

Passive• Something is done by

someone.

BeThe car was built by Ford.

Page 4: Passive Voice INVENTIONS

Be

Ford will produce the Fiesta car again.Fiesta will be produced again.

Be

Ford has made Ford Eco Sport for 10 years.Eco sport has been made for 10 years.

Page 13: Passive Voice INVENTIONS

The Ferrari 250 GTO is often considered to be one of the top sports cars of all time. It was built for racing in the early 1960s and at that time, would have cost $18,000 – well over $100,000 by today’s standards if inflation is taken into account. Potential buyers had to be personally approved by Enzo Ferrari himself. Only 39 models were made.
